Why Don't More Chinese People Wear Yao Ming's Jersey?
When Yao proves that he is the best in the NBA, when he's an MVP, when he's the most transcendant player on the floor, then he'll sell a lot more jerseys in China...or is it because everybody in China already has his jersey? Yao was saying it half jokingly, but it's probably true. Why would anyone buy the same jersey twice?? Wait till the rockets release a new jersey, then we'll see about sales.
